Orkla and Hydro build a joint venture called Sapa

Orkla ASA and Norsk Hydro ASA has agreed to merge Sapa and Hydro Profile Extruded Products and Building Systems Operations.

The new company will be called Sapa is a joint venture in which Orkla and Hydro owns 50% each. Completion of the transaction is expected to take place in the first half of 2013, following approvals from relevant competition authorities. Until this is done, the two operations continue as independent companies.

The new company forms the world's leading aluminium solutions provider with unique capabilities for technical support, product development and logistics.
